<p>A cholesteric liquid crystal display device uses a general-purpose STN liquid crystal driver where consumption energy is reduced with a small increase of a circuit area and circuit cost. The device performs a first step for making a pixel in a planar state and a second step for increasing a mix ratio of a focal conic state in the pixel. The device is provided with a voltage generating circuit and driver circuits (28, 29) applying a voltage pulse to the pixel based on prescribed voltage from the voltage generating circuit. The voltage generating circuit is provided with a boosting part (41) generating boosting voltage from power voltage, a voltage switching part (42) generating a voltage control signal and a voltage stabilizing part (43) generating prescribed voltage corresponding to the voltage control signal from boosting voltage. The voltage stabilizing part (43) suppresses output voltage fluctuation with respect to fluctuation of boosting voltage. The boosting part switches a boosting ratio in the first step and the second step.</p> |
